changeset 1731:778056dc420f
Fixed editing properties on FileClass nodes.
Previously, if there was no 'content' property in the form when
editing properties, other changes wold be discarded silently. Now, an
exception is raised when there is a empty content property. Also, when
there is no content property, other attributes can be edited.
